Was looking at a post the other day and saw how bad things can get when grounds are poor. Fires, poor electrics etc.

My question: How many grounds exist ¸on a 78 standard and where are they?

I think I cleaned up most of them but it is the one you don't know about that gets you.
 
Grounds... hmm...

1. battery to frame under the seat, that's the main one.
2. clean motor mount between engine and frame, the triangle at top rear of trany is a good one. Clean between frame/bracket and bracket/engine to make sure engine is grounded to frame and can be done with bike in frame.
3. coils need a good ground.
4. handlebars ground through the handlebar holders to both switches, often missed.
5. most other grounds are the black wires through out the harness.

that's a start...
 
yes almost all grounding is done thru the black wire(s) in the loom, there is battery frame ground and a top motor mount to frame, coils or condensers really since the dual coils don't need grounded (ground is the points), a lot of guys also run a large ring terminal/wire from under one of handlebar risers to frame (makes sure the handle bar switches are grounded)
